1. Kirby- Saban long past retirement age or Kirby pre 50. No brainer.
2. Saban- Don't know how long I'd have him, but if it's three years the next coach would be set up for success.
3. Kelly- Best coach left, maybe not the best recruiter.
4. Stoops- Have no idea why this guy isn't entertaining offers at bigger football schools. If he can recruit at an elite school, he's in playoff almost annually starting next year.
5. Kiffin- In college, he's been successful everywhere but USC. That may have been due to what he inherited there. Hasn't exactly been easy for most of the others either.
6. Heupel- He's. good coach, but that offense has a ceiling and works better at a school that can't recruit well. The defense will never be much better than average as long as he's there.
7. Pittman- Perfect fit where he's at. He'll be there until he's ready to quit.
8. Freeze- He's a good coach, but a sketchy person. And wasn't that careful with his cheating (not just on his wife, on NCAA rules)
9. Jimbo - Don't want the frustration of a roller coaster ride.
10. Beamer- Good coach. Can he recruit well enough to get them back to mid Spurrier years level?
11. Napier- Turning around recruiting right now. Maybe there is hope.
12. Lea- Another Franklin? If so, Vandy will be hiring a new coach soon.
13. Drink- Needs to show improvement this year.
14. Sark- Been at some big time schools. Big time wins? Not so much.
15. Venables- Inherited a Rolls. Driving it like it's a Pinto.
16. Arnett- Have no idea how this guy is a as a HC. Hope they give him at least a year. The offensive change could be ugly his first year. But no defensive minded coach was gonna continue with the air raid/veer and shoot type stuff.
